Stephanie Marie Hwang Kroll, DDS, Dentist

2901 Loma Vista Rd
VenturaCA  93003-2915 (Ventura County)


Phone: 805-643-7516
Fax: 805-643-0476

NPI: 1790160547
License Number: 64792 (CA)